The release of SharecareNow 10 - Depression coincides with the nationally recognized Seasonal Depression Awareness Month, which takes place every December to increase awareness for seasonal affective disorder (SAD), a type of depression that affects half a million people every winter, peaking in December, January and February.(1) Episodes of SAD typically occur during this time due to the reduced amount of sunlight, shorter days, and possible loneliness during the holiday months. The symptoms for SAD include feelings of sadness, sluggishness, lack of motivation, withdrawal from social activities, increased appetite and changes in sleep patterns.(2)

According to the World Federation for Mental Health, depression can take many different forms and affect people of all ages, races, religions and incomes worldwide. In fact, in the U.S. alone, an estimated 1 in 10 American adults report that they experience some degree of depression.(3)

Studies show that depression is two to three times more common in women, as well as increased in people that have a family history of the condition, are exposed to violence, are suffering from other chronic diseases, or are economically or socially disadvantaged. Furthermore, individuals with depression are more at risk for other disorders, including suicide, substance abuse, anxiety disorders, heart disease, stroke, HIV/AIDS, and diabetes.(4)

WFMH was founded in 1948 to advance, among all peoples and nations, the prevention of mental and emotional disorders, the proper treatment and care of those with such disorders, and the promotion of mental health. The Federation, through its members and contacts in more than 100 countries on six continents, has responded to international mental health crises through its role as the only worldwide grassroots advocacy and public education organization in the mental health field.
